There is no greater night of the year in Rye and so it has been down the ages.

Rye Bonfire Society put on a fantastic show every year and it is a free show that all the family can enjoy. The Boys (and Girls) work hard all year round raising cash to produce the colourful spectacle that people from all over the World come to see.

The important thing is ALL the money collected in the boxes and buckets goes to help local charities. So please be generous on the night.
